Kentucky Cost of Living Index

Kentucky's Regional Price Parity (RPP) is 89.4, meaning prices are 10.6% lower the national average. A Emergency Medical Technicians earning $35,670 in Kentucky has the equivalent purchasing power of $39,899 in an average-cost US state.

Salary Breakdown: Nominal vs. COL-Adjusted

Every dollar goes further in low-cost states. Here is how each salary percentile compares after adjusting for Kentucky's cost of living.

Percentile Nominal Salary COL-Adjusted Difference
10th Percentile (P10) $28,520 $31,901 +$3,381
25th Percentile (P25) $30,770 $34,418 +$3,648
Median (P50) $35,670 $39,899 +$4,229
75th Percentile (P75) $43,720 $48,903 +$5,183
90th Percentile (P90) $59,200 $66,219 +$7,019

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the real salary for a Emergency Medical Technicians in Kentucky after cost of living?

A Emergency Medical Technicians in Kentucky earns a median salary of $35,670 per year. After adjusting for Kentucky's cost of living (RPP=89.4), the real purchasing power is $39,899 — a +11.9% difference.

Is Kentucky expensive to live in?

Kentucky's cost of living is 10.6% lower than the national average according to the BEA Regional Price Parities (2022). The RPP index for Kentucky is 89.4 (US average = 100).

What are Regional Price Parities (RPP)?

Regional Price Parities (RPPs) are price indexes published by the U.S. Bureau of Economic Analysis (BEA) that measure differences in price levels across states. They are expressed as a percentage of the national average (US = 100). Higher RPP means higher cost of living.

How is the cost-of-living adjusted salary calculated?

The adjusted salary is calculated as: Nominal Salary x (100 / RPP). For a Emergency Medical Technicians in Kentucky: $35,670 x (100 / 89.4) = $39,899. This represents what the salary would be worth in a state with average living costs.
